4 Ga. men sentenced in steroid distribution scheme

By Associated Press

ATLANTA (AP) Federal prosecutors say four men have been sentenced in a steroid distribution scheme involving raw materials imported from China.

Authorities say 41-year-old Brandon Franklin of Canton and 30-year-old Jay Reger of Woodstock were sentenced to two years in prison. Officials say 25-year-old Andrew Chrismer of Atlanta was sentenced to a year in prison, and 25-year-old Austin Shirley of Acworth was sentenced to two years of probation.

Prosecutors say Franklin and Reger produced and sold steroids online under the name Performance Formulations. Prosecutors say Franklin managed the group's website, Reger mixed materials and Shirley and Chrismer filled orders.

Officials say Franklin used profits to fund a luxurious lifestyle.
